Designed in North America and built in Austria, the Atomic Maven 93 C is a wildly versatile all-mountain women's ski that's been tested and validated by the Atomic #sheskis ambassador team. OMatic Core uses lightweight triaxial fiberglass and carbon layers paired with precision milled poplar wood to create the ultimate balance of stability and flex throughout the length of the ski. The Flow Profile delivers the ideal combination of camber, shovel taper, and tip rocker while HRZN tech in the tip creates 10% more surface area, allowing the ski to float through fresh snow and hook up on hardpack. Exact and relaxed, the Maven 93 C delivers the performance and versatility to ski the entire mountain in any snow condition-hardpack to powder.

A ski without boundaries, Atomic Maverick 95 Ti is a wildly versatile all-mountain ski. The OMatic Construction uses a Titanal layer to create the ideal balance of stiffness and flex, delivering stability from tip to tail. Ample side cut paired with all-mountain rocker allow this ski to handle every condition it encounters. HRZN tech expands the surface area of the tip by 10% to create a ski with intuitive handling regardless of snow conditions. Designed in North America and built in Austria, the Maverick 95 Ti is capable of skiing every mountain and every snow condition - hardpack to powder.

All resort. All the time. The women's Experience 86 Basalt ski blends a lightweight build with a smooth ride for carving across the entire mountain. The flex is tuned for intermediate and advanced skiers who enjoy an aggressive performance. A paulownia wood core reduces overall weight, while basalt layers absorb vibration for a smooth, quiet feel. An 86mm waist adds versatility and stability across changing snow conditions. The confidence-boosting control of our Drive Tip design works with the sidecut and full sidewall construction for smooth turn initiation and a powerful edge through the entire turn.

DRIVE TIP SOLUTION
- Blending directional fibers in the tip of the ski with soft viscose material through the forebody, our new Drive Tip Solution harnesses and eliminates vibrations moving through undulating terrain and harsh snow conditions for confidence-boosting touch and control.
BOOST FLEX
- While some choose to charge hard, others prefer a more relaxed approach to the slopes. Our new ADAPTIVE FLEX answers the needs of every skier with three unique flex profiles (BOOST, ACTIVE, ASSIST) to ensure the right flex for the right feel. BOOST FLEX is designed to deliver the most responsive energy transmission for dynamic power and performance.

Punch the gas with the Salomon STANCE 88, a women's-specific, all-mountain ski in Salomon's brand-new, hard-charging Stance series. The STANCE 88 is an all-mountain shredder powered by revolutionary Metal TwinFrame technology.
Edge grip
- When a race-inspired sidecut pairs up with a Metal Twinframe laminate the result is confidence-inspiring edge grip whether you're laying down a turn on piste or off.
Maneuverable and progressive
- A frontside sidecut teams up with a mix karuba poplar woodcore and C/FX creating unmatched confidence when you're railing a turn on piste or racing through the glades.
Power
- Metal Twinframe technology pairs with C/FX and a mix karuba poplar woodcore to create a damp, hard-charging ski that inspires confidence regardless of speed and terrain.
Karuba / Poplar Full Woodcore
- Woodcore is a mix between poplar and karuba, to offer a specific women construction. Karuba offers lightweight and inertia.
Metal Twin Frame
- A titanal top core TI layer provides improved stability, while the recessed windows, strategically placed in the tip and tail, frame Salomon's proprietary C/FX fiber layer to help release torsion for increased maneuverability and dampening.

Enjoy fresh powder in the morning. Rip tight turns on the slope in the afternoon. The re-engineered AX with its new FEC adaptive technology makes it all possible. The more pressure you apply in the turns, the smaller the rocker is, and the correspondingly larger the surface contact area is with the snow. The new Light Core lends the AX even more pop with the same stability.
